MCC Chennai offers a Bachelor of Computer Application (BCA) program with the following features:
- The Department of Computer Science commenced in 2001 and has since grown to have two sections with a total strength of 300 students.
- The program aims to provide high-quality training through cutting-edge computer technology, with a curriculum that is constantly upgraded to cope with the rapidly changing facets of computer technology.
- The Under Graduate Programme spans three years, divided into six semesters with 140 credits under the Choice-Based Credit System (CBCS).

To apply for B.Sc. in Microbiology at MCC Chennai, candidates must have a pass in the Tamil Nadu Higher Secondary or equivalent Examination with plus two marks. The upper age limit for admission to UG courses is 21 years as on 1st July 2025, with relaxation of 5 years for differently-abled and 3 years for women students. Candidates from Boards other than Tamil Nadu State Board, CBSE, AISSCE, and ISCE must produce an Eligibility Certificate from the University of Madras. The online application portal will be open, and admissions will start only after the 12th results are declared by the Government of Tamil Nadu.

Yes, private companies hire from B.Sc. in Microbiology at MCC Chennai. Some of the companies that have hired students from this program include Tata Chemicals Ltd., Sachika, Lifecell, and Thomson Reuters. The college has a placement cell that aids in organizing campus recruitment drives and internship opportunities for students.
